Verdict: The i7-14700K is around 4% faster than the i5-14600K on average — a modest edge you may notice in demanding titles, but not a generational leap.

At launch pricing, the i5-14600K offers more performance per dollar, and the i7-14700K is the more power-efficient chip.

Frequently asked questions

Is the i7-14700K better than the i5-14600K?

Yes — based on aggregated benchmark data, the i7-14700K is about 4% faster than the i5-14600K on average.

How much faster is the i7-14700K than the i5-14600K?

Roughly 4% on average in gaming workloads. The gap varies by title, resolution and settings.

Which processor is better value?

Comparing launch prices, the i5-14600K delivers more performance per dollar. Check current street prices, as market pricing often shifts the value equation.
